Main Street Capital Corporation is close to a major resistance level, whereby the breach of this level could be considered as a buy signal. This reflects our preferred scenario in light of the stock's current technical chart pattern.
Strengths● The company's earnings per share (EPS) are expected to grow significantly over the next few years according to the consensus of analysts covering the stock.
● The group's activity appears highly profitable thanks to its outperforming net margins.
● This company will be of major interest to investors in search of a high dividend stock.
● Over the last twelve months, the sales forecast has been frequently revised upwards.
● Growth remains a strong point in this company. In their sales forecast, analysts sound optimistic with regard to sales prospects.
● For the past year, analysts covering the stock have been revising their EPS expectations upwards in a significant manner.
● For the last 4 months, the company has been enjoying highly positive EPS revisions, which were frequently and significantly raised.
● Over the past twelve months, analysts' opinions have been strongly revised upwards.
● Predictions on business development from analysts polled by Standard & Poor's are tight. This results from either a good visibility into core activities or accurate earnings releases.
● Historically, the company has been releasing figures that are above expectations.
